The Consumer Confidence Report (CCR) is a regulation, passed by the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) as part of the 1996 Safe Drinking Water Act Amendments, that requires all community water systems to provide their customers with an annual water quality report. With the CCR, communities benefit by gaining a better understanding of their water suppliers and the processes involved, which allows them an opportunity to make an informed decision regarding their use of drinking water. This report is a summary of the quality of the water Azle provides its customers. The CCR also provides the City of Azle with an opportunity to explain how the community’s drinking water supplies are protected.
